Purpose of Public Hearing
Landscaping and Lighting Act of 1972
1.(Section 22628) Any interested person, prior to the
conclusion of the hearing, may file a written
protest with the clerk, stating their objection to the
assessment and Engineer’s report as filed
2.(Section 22630) During the hearing, the City
Council may order changes in any of the matters
provided in the Engineer’s report;
3.(Section 22630.5) If there is a majority protest
against the increase of the assessment from any
previous year, the proposed increase in the
assessment shall be abandoned .
4.(Section 22631) If a majority protest has not been
filed, the City Council may adopt a resolution
confirming the diagram and assessment, either
as originally proposed or as changed.

Background
•Formed in 2011 to generate revenue
to reconstruct, repair and maintain the
29 median islands along Point San
Pedro Road
•Both City and County properties are
assessed
•City of San Rafael designated as the
lead agency

Assessment
Two components
1.Capital debt service assessment
–Debt service associated with the large
capital costs of re-constructing the
medians in 2014 ($1,750,000)
2.Operations and maintenance
assessment
–Monthly contractual maintenance,
landscaping repairs and plant
replacement, irrigation system
maintenance and repairs, utilities,
financial services

Assessment Increase
•FY 2018-19 was the first year
with an increase ($4.50)
•FY 2019-20 increase proposed:
$12.90 (maximum allowed)
Assessment portion FY 2018-19 Proposed
FY 2019-20
Change
Capital & Debt Service $52.78 $52.78 $0
Operations and Maintenance $31.20 $44.10 $12.90
Total $83.98 $96.88 $12.90

Why the increase
•Revenue generated has not covered
the actual operations and
maintenance costs for the 29
medians
Operations and Maintenance Budget FY 2019-20
Monthly contractual maintenance $80,000
Landscaping Rehabilitation/Repair $10,000
Irrigation repairs $5,100
Utilities (Water + Electricity)$33,093
Engineer’s Report $10,000
County Fee $5,900
Total $144,093
FY 2018-19 Revenues: $96K

Maintenance Issues
•Oversight of maintenance contractor
•Soil conditions affecting plant growth
•Broken or damaged irrigation lines
•Replacement and removal of dead
plants and litter removal
However, over the last 2-3 years the City and
the Roadway Committee have made
considerable progress on resolving these
issues

Proposition 218
Since the proposed assessment of
$96.88 for FY 2019-20 is the maximum
allowed rate of $96.88 (were it
increased 3% or CPI each year as
allowed), the assessment district does
not need to return to the voters of the
assessment district for the increase per
Proposition 218

Options
1.Conduct the public hearing and adopt the
resolution, thus ordering the levy of
assessments for fiscal year 2019-20.
2.Do not adopt the resolution, which will result
in no levy of assessments for Fiscal Year
2019-20. This may result in an inability for the
required maintenance on the Point San Pedro
to be performed, as there will be no revenue
for the assessment district collected in the
coming year if the levy of assessments is not
approved.
